Members of Epinmi Class of ’78, who graduated from African Church Teacher’s Training College at Epinmi, Akoko East local government area of Ondo State in 1978 have called on the federal government to reestablish teachers’ training colleges across the country.
They said the return of the schools would enhance the quality of teaching in schools at the grassroots.
The old students spoke last Saturday when they returned to their alma mater 44 years after for their 2022 annual general meeting (AGM).
In a press release signed by the national public relations officer of Epinmi Class of ’78, Otunba Dapo Olaosebikan, he observed that everyone in the group, now all senior citizens, was very ecstatic for the reunion at their alma mater, though now a unity secondary school in the historic town of Epinmi Akoko.
